User researchers employ a diverse range of methodologies to gather insights on user behavior and preferences. They analyze data to identify patterns, trends, and areas for improvement in game design, ensuring an engaging and satisfying user experience. 2. Player Psychologist:
Player psychologists utilize psychological principles and theories to understand player motivations, emotions, and behaviors. By applying their knowledge of human cognition and behavior, they help create immersive game environments that foster player loyalty and enjoyment. 3. UX Designer:
UX designers are responsible for creating user-centric game interfaces and experiences. They apply design principles and user feedback to improve game flow, navigation, and overall usability, leading to increased player satisfaction and reduced churn. 4. Data Analyst:
Data analysts interpret complex data sets to derive actionable insights for game developers. By identifying trends, patterns, and correlations, they help optimize game design, monetization strategies, and user engagement, driving business growth.
